在網(wǎng)頁開發(fā)中,經(jīng)常需要用到彈出窗口的交互方式。而javascript:;彈出窗口則是其中一種常見的方式。在本文中,我們將詳細(xì)講解javascript:;彈出窗口的用法和實現(xiàn)方法。
首先,我們需要了解javascript:;彈出窗口的基本用法。一般而言,我們可以通過在HTML中添加一個a標(biāo)簽,并設(shè)置其href屬性為javascript:;來實現(xiàn)彈出窗口。例如,以下代碼將創(chuàng)建一個a標(biāo)簽,點擊后將彈出一個警告窗口:
在這個例子中,我們使用了alert()函數(shù)來彈出一個警告窗口,并將其放置在了javascript:;的位置上。當(dāng)用戶點擊這個鏈接時,警告窗口將被顯示出來,并顯示“Hello, World!”的文字內(nèi)容。
此外,我們還可以使用其他的彈出方式,例如創(chuàng)建一個confirm()對話框或prompt()對話框。以下代碼將創(chuàng)建一個a標(biāo)簽,點擊后將彈出一個確認(rèn)對話框:
在這個例子中,我們使用了confirm()函數(shù)來彈出一個確認(rèn)對話框。如果用戶點擊了確認(rèn)按鈕,就會執(zhí)行alert()函數(shù)并彈出一個警告框,顯示“OK!”的文字內(nèi)容。
類似地,我們還可以使用prompt()函數(shù)來創(chuàng)建一個輸入對話框,并得到用戶輸入的內(nèi)容。例如,以下代碼將創(chuàng)建一個a標(biāo)簽,點擊后將彈出一個輸入對話框:
在這個例子中,我們使用了prompt()函數(shù)來彈出一個輸入對話框,并賦值給變量name。然后我們使用alert()函數(shù)來彈出一個警告框,顯示“Hello, ”和輸入的姓名。
除了使用a標(biāo)簽來實現(xiàn)javascript:;彈出窗口之外,我們還可以通過編寫javascript代碼來實現(xiàn)。例如,以下代碼將創(chuàng)建一個button標(biāo)簽,點擊后將彈出一個警告框:
在這個例子中,我們在button標(biāo)簽中添加了onclick事件,并將alert()函數(shù)放在其中。當(dāng)用戶點擊這個按鈕時,警告窗口將被顯示出來,并顯示“Hello, World!”的文字內(nèi)容。
綜上所述,javascript:;彈出窗口是實現(xiàn)網(wǎng)頁交互的一種簡單而常用的方式。通過在HTML中添加a標(biāo)簽或編寫javascript代碼,我們可以方便地實現(xiàn)警告窗口、確認(rèn)對話框和輸入對話框等彈出窗口效果。
首先,我們需要了解javascript:;彈出窗口的基本用法。一般而言,我們可以通過在HTML中添加一個a標(biāo)簽,并設(shè)置其href屬性為javascript:;來實現(xiàn)彈出窗口。例如,以下代碼將創(chuàng)建一個a標(biāo)簽,點擊后將彈出一個警告窗口:
<a href="javascript:alert('Hello, World!');">Click Me!</a>
在這個例子中,我們使用了alert()函數(shù)來彈出一個警告窗口,并將其放置在了javascript:;的位置上。當(dāng)用戶點擊這個鏈接時,警告窗口將被顯示出來,并顯示“Hello, World!”的文字內(nèi)容。
此外,我們還可以使用其他的彈出方式,例如創(chuàng)建一個confirm()對話框或prompt()對話框。以下代碼將創(chuàng)建一個a標(biāo)簽,點擊后將彈出一個確認(rèn)對話框:
<a href="javascript:if(confirm('Are you sure?')){alert('OK!');}">Click Me!</a>
在這個例子中,我們使用了confirm()函數(shù)來彈出一個確認(rèn)對話框。如果用戶點擊了確認(rèn)按鈕,就會執(zhí)行alert()函數(shù)并彈出一個警告框,顯示“OK!”的文字內(nèi)容。
類似地,我們還可以使用prompt()函數(shù)來創(chuàng)建一個輸入對話框,并得到用戶輸入的內(nèi)容。例如,以下代碼將創(chuàng)建一個a標(biāo)簽,點擊后將彈出一個輸入對話框:
<a href="javascript:var name=prompt('What is your name?');alert('Hello, '+name+'!');">Click Me!</a>
在這個例子中,我們使用了prompt()函數(shù)來彈出一個輸入對話框,并賦值給變量name。然后我們使用alert()函數(shù)來彈出一個警告框,顯示“Hello, ”和輸入的姓名。
除了使用a標(biāo)簽來實現(xiàn)javascript:;彈出窗口之外,我們還可以通過編寫javascript代碼來實現(xiàn)。例如,以下代碼將創(chuàng)建一個button標(biāo)簽,點擊后將彈出一個警告框:
<button onclick="alert('Hello, World!');">Click Me!</button>
在這個例子中,我們在button標(biāo)簽中添加了onclick事件,并將alert()函數(shù)放在其中。當(dāng)用戶點擊這個按鈕時,警告窗口將被顯示出來,并顯示“Hello, World!”的文字內(nèi)容。
綜上所述,javascript:;彈出窗口是實現(xiàn)網(wǎng)頁交互的一種簡單而常用的方式。通過在HTML中添加a標(biāo)簽或編寫javascript代碼,我們可以方便地實現(xiàn)警告窗口、確認(rèn)對話框和輸入對話框等彈出窗口效果。
上一篇javascriptok
下一篇javascript七牛